Basement Concrete Sealing in Sarasota, FL

Basement concrete sealing is a service designed to protect and preserve concrete surfaces in residential basements. It involves applying a specialized sealant that acts as a barrier against moisture, water intrusion, and potential damage caused by humidity or leaks. This service is often requested for projects such as sealing basement floors, walls, or foundation surfaces to improve durability, prevent cracking, and reduce the risk of mold or mildew growth. Homeowners typically seek this service when they notice excess dampness, water seepage, or want to maintain the longevity of their basement concrete structures.

Before requesting basement concrete sealing, property owners usually want to understand the current condition of the concrete surface, including any existing cracks or moisture issues. It's important to consider the type of sealant used, its suitability for the specific basement environment, and whether any surface preparation is necessary prior to sealing. Proper surface cleaning and repair of existing cracks may be recommended to ensure the best results.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ions about the scope of work needed to protect their basement space effectively.

Common Basement Concrete Sealing Jobs

Basement floor sealing - helps prevent moisture infiltration and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Crawl space sealing - protects against soil dampness and enhances indoor air quality.

Garage floor sealing - provides a durable surface resistant to stains, cracks, and wear.

Foundation sealing - shields concrete structures from water damage and structural deterioration.

Interior basement sealing - creates a moisture barrier to improve comfort and prevent musty odors.

Exterior basement sealing - stops water from seeping through foundation walls during heavy rains.

Basement Concrete Sealing Questions

What is basement concrete sealing? It is a process that applies a protective coating to basement floors and walls to prevent moisture penetration and staining.

Why should homeowners consider sealing their basement concrete? Sealing helps reduce water damage, mold growth, and surface deterioration, maintaining the integrity of the space.

What types of basement projects benefit from concrete sealing? Areas prone to dampness, such as crawl spaces or unfinished basements, often see improved durability and appearance with sealing.

How often should basement concrete be resealed? Typically, resealing every few years helps maintain protection, depending on the level of use and exposure to moisture.
